    If your uPVC windows won't close properly, it could be due to a gap between the frame and the sash. This can not only cause draughts but can also lead to water damage and damp. To test this, you can try placing a piece of paper between the sash and the frame to see if the frame can be closed.

    To repair this, you'll need to remove the seal around the frame and sash. Then, you will need to remove the gearbox that locks from its place inside the frame. This will require the assistance of a tool, such as an flat screwdriver or torch to reach the gearbox. After removing the gearbox you will need to replace it with a new one that is identical in size and design.

    A leaking UPVC could be the result of various circumstances, including weather conditions or general wear and tear. These factors can cause the UPVC window's frame to crack or be damaged. It is costly to repair this damage, so seek out a specialist to fix it.

    Another common problem is water condensation between glass panes of your double-glazed UPVC windows. This happens when the window frames have not been fitted correctly, or if the nail fins are damaged and are no longer able to offer a reliable seal. A uPVC specialist will replace the seals to ensure that the window is sealed properly, preventing drafts. This will increase energy efficiency and prevent drafts.
